13 Example Sentences Showcasing the Meaning of 'Unproven'

The scientist cautioned against drawing conclusions from the unproven hypothesis, urging further research.

The teacher reminded the elementary students not to believe in unproven rumors without verifying the facts.

Legal experts emphasized the importance of relying on proven evidence rather than unproven allegations in court proceedings.

The journalist faced criticism for publishing an article based on unproven sources, damaging the credibility of the news outlet.

The athlete refused to use the unproven supplement, prioritizing evidence-based approaches to enhance performance.

The historian emphasized the need to distinguish between proven historical events and unproven anecdotes passed down through generations.

Environmentalists warned against implementing unproven technologies, emphasizing the potential risks to the ecosystem.

The new drug is unproven and requires further clinical trials.

The unproven theory sparked heated debates among scientific researchers.

The unproven allegations against the politician led to a public outcry.

The unproven hypothesis left the researchers searching for conclusive evidence.

The athlete was cautious about using unproven performance-enhancing supplements.

The unproven link between the two events raised skepticism among experts.
